Troubleshoot lighting issues

Using the AnyScene Buttons

If the buttons don’t respond it will be because something else is controlling the lights, this could be:

  • The main lighting desk - found within the left-most AV console.

Remove either of the two leads connected to the rear of the lighting desk and control will be returned to the wall buttons.

  • LightKey on the iMac - the ProPresenter iMac can run a piece of software called LightKey which can control the lights.

Remove the lead connected to the white socket at the back of the space behind the radio receivers and CD player.

Fluorescent Lighting

We generally avoid using the flourescent lights during services and other events, but they can be useful when first arriving in the building.

Note: These are not under control of main lighting desk or AnyScene buttons.

How to turn on/off

Use the switches by the Ogle Road or Lounge doors, or the switch in the projection room under the window to the right of the main projector.

The switches aren't working

The auditorium switches are disabled when the main projection room switches are turned on.
